NAMO LOYE SAVVASAHOONAM

NAMO LOYE SAVVASAHOONAM

Meaning;

  • Obeisance to all the monks and nuns.
  • Monk is the one who practices the five great vows called mahavarats viz non-violence, truth, non-stealing, celibacy, and non-possession.
  • Characteristic qualities (inherent powers): Twenty Seven.

Methodology of chanting:

  • Choose any suitable and comfortable posture, face east or north direction and Chant line

OM NAMO LOYE SAVVASAHOONAM

while concentrating at the bottom portion of the spinal cord (Shakti Kendra) visualizing the dark blue colour. Advantages:
Develops the energy and disease resistance power Pacifies the ill effects of the planets Saturn, Rahu and Ketu.

Mudra:

  • Muni Mudra.

Process:

  • Raise both hands making hollow of the palm while inhaling, lower down tf with folded hands while exhaling.
